>>>>> The attached patch adds support for intel's rdrand intrinsics to LLVM.
>>>>> 
>>>>> The tricky part is that the intrinsics have to return two values (the random value and the carry flag). This is solved with a pointer argument and a cmov to materialize CF, which matches GCC's output. This approach requires some custom lowering code, but I don't see a way to do it with tablegenerated patterns only.
>>>> 
>>>> It would be much more friendly to the optimizer to use multiple return
>>>> values... but it might not be worth the hassle, considering that
>>>> rdrand is relatively slow.
>>> 
>>> I tried this first as it also looks cleaner, but I couldn't find a way to smuggle it past legalization into the target specific lowering.
>> 
>> X86TargetLowering::ReplaceNodeResults?
> 
> Doesn't work because TLI.getOperationAction bails out early when it sees an extended type. The legalizer then tries to expand the node and aborts.

Apparently I made some mistake yesterday, it *does* work without applying any tricks as long as all return values are legal individually. I attached an updated patch which uses the following intrinsic signature, allowing the store to stay in IR.

declare { i16, i32 } @llvm.x86.rdrand.16()

Here i16 is the random value and i32 is the boolean indicating whether it is considered valid. I also attached the clang part of this patch and reverified that the code matches what ICC and GCC emit.
